The hamburger's origins are debated, with various claims dating back to the late 19th and early 20th centuries. It evolved from German Hamburg steak to a sandwich form in the US, becoming a staple with the rise of fast food in the mid-20th century.

Burgers are deeply embedded in American culture, representing convenience, affordability, and casual dining. They are a common sight at backyard barbecues, sporting events, and fast-food restaurants.
American Staple
Burgers are one of the most recognizable and popular foods in the United States, often associated with American identity and lifestyle.
Social Gathering Food
Burgers are frequently served at casual gatherings, picnics, and cookouts, fostering a sense of community and informality.
Fast Food Icon
Burgers are a cornerstone of the fast-food industry, offering a quick and affordable meal option for busy individuals and families.

Patty Perfection
Use high-quality ground beef with a good fat content (around 80/20) for a juicy and flavorful patty. Avoid over-handling the meat to prevent a tough texture.
Cheese Melt
Place the cheese on the patty during the last minute of grilling or cooking to ensure a perfectly melted and gooey texture.
Sauce Application
Apply the PK sauce generously on both the top and bottom bun for even flavor distribution and to prevent a dry burger.
Bun Choice
A slightly toasted bun can add texture and prevent sogginess. Consider brioche or potato buns for added flavor.
